One main theme is ambition. The protagonist is so focused on his work and career advancement that he risks his life. Another theme is the value of life. When he is in a dangerous situation on the ledge, he realizes there are things more important than work.

The protagonist is a career - driven individual. He lives in an apartment and has a piece of work (the paper) that he values so much that he risks his life for it. He is the central character around whom all the action and self - discovery in the story revolves.
